Transaction 8973fba724a7f383ca67e9867fc6a0352e7e69e7d59eb9682c1d96d553fa0aa5

1 Input
2 Outputs
  • 8973fba724a7f383ca67e9867fc6a0352e7e69e7d59eb9682c1d96d553fa0aa5:0
  • value  10000000
    address  1MbZvDT3zneZrkaiG45tzVp8EMtygPvbUb
  • 8973fba724a7f383ca67e9867fc6a0352e7e69e7d59eb9682c1d96d553fa0aa5:1
  • value  29016717
    address  18EtJgo3zUQib8xBz1dZ8WMk4mn8oRgNkE